1. Project summary and work plan
Patient engagement in healthcare is a priority and an essential component of clinical practice. Health research is, in fact, the foundation for building this engagement. By involving patients, clinicians, and researchers, this project aims to
- design a genetic counseling program for the implementation of a new healthcare service in Portugal: expanded carrier screening. The program will be developed in a scientifically sound, ethically rigorous, and socially responsible manner. The project's main objective is to generate the scientific knowledge still lacking, enabling the
- design and implementation of a nationalGeneticCounseling Program for PreconceptionalExpandedCarrierScreening (Gen
CECS). The ultimate goal of this program is to empower couples at reproductive age, increasing their informed reproductive choices and autonomy.
Research Plan and Methods: The experience gained will ultimately serve to build a roadmap for the responsible implementation of a national Genetic Counseling for Preconceptional Expanded Carrier Screening (Gen
CECS) program.
- A survey will be conducted on attitudes among different groups of couples of reproductive age to assess acceptance and the anticipated impact of implementing this service.
- The evidence obtained will support the development of a genetic counseling protocol, addressing the needs and expectations of couples and healthcare professionals, and proposing best practice guidelines.
- Finally, we will pilot and begin implementing a national Extended Preconception Carrier Screening program, for which we will develop appropriate communication materials, promote genetic education for healthcare professionals and the general public, and conduct various outreach activities.
- Quantitative and qualitative data analyses will utilize sound statistical methods and tools.
